Re: v9.0 strategy positions with IB  [SOLVED]

Postby Henry MultiСharts » 30 Oct 2014

We have identified an issue with Balance values not updating when using IB Financial Advisor account. This issue will be fixed in MultiCharts 9.0 Release 2.
  1. There were no issues with position/PnL updates. If you have any - please do the following:
  2. Please close all charts/DOMs/Scanners for this instrument.
  3. Disconnect IB broker profile.
  4. Delete the symbol mapping for this instrument.
  5. Re-add the symbol from the data source.
    In QuoteManager please go to Instrument tab->Add symbol->From data source->IB.
  6. Plot the chart/DOM window for the IB instrument you need
    or add the mapping manually if you are using a non IB data feed for your chart.

Re: v9.0 strategy positions with IB

Postby eunos64 » 03 Nov 2014

Strategy positions issue have been solved.

It works perfectly after some procedures....
-Install Windows and other applications including MC 9.0 on brand new SSD drive.
-From my backup data, Copy and paste files "FBPORTFOLIO.GDB, TSCACHE.GDB, TSSTORAGE.GDB" in folder C:\ProgramData\TS Support\MultiCharts .NET64\Databases except for files "Dictionary, Dictionary.ucs".
-Add some symbol roots in symbol dictionary like "N225M, SGXNK.....etc..." not listed in default dictionary.

This is my case.
It will work with normal update process and with Henry's suggestion maybe.
